Free Medical Care in Kherson Region: Impact of Fortitude Mobile Clinics

(Photo: HOVA)

Last week, a team of doctors worked in Bila Krynytsia, Karyerne, Pervomaisk, Bilousove and Tverdomedove.

According to the Kherson Regional Medical Association, more than 250 residents of Beryslav district received free medical care thanks to the work of Fortitude mobile clinics.

"The reception was conducted by a family doctor, a neurologist, an endocrinologist and a cardiologist, who made an electrocardiogram if necessary," the statement said.

In addition, specialists conducted ultrasound of organs and laboratory tests in the "clinic on wheels". If necessary, patients were given free medicines and glasses.

Photo: Kherson Regional Medical Association

The administration also noted that the Kherson Mobile Clinics project is being implemented by the Fortitude Charitable Foundation in cooperation with the International Rescue Committee in Ukraine with the support of the Humanitarian Foundation for Ukraine and the UN Office for the Coordination of Humanitarian Affairs.

Earlier, more than 280 residents of Kalinovka, Novopoltavka, Bobrovy Kut and Blagodatovka received free medical aid fromFortitude's specialists. Prior to that, volunteer doctors visited Ivanivka, Mykolaivka, Olzhynoye, Mala Shestirna, Novohryhorivske, Topolyne, Fedorivka and Kniazivka. The team of the mobile clinic of the Palianytsia Foundation PAL-UA also made several visits to the settlements of Kherson region. They examined 62 patients and held 97 consultations. Then the mobile clinic visited the villages of Myroliubivka, Fedorivka and Yevhenivka. A family doctor also joined the team. They examined 78 people and held 90 consultations. Volunteer dentists also treated 195 residents of the Kalynivka community. At the initiative of the Kalynivka UIA and the local outpatient clinic, volunteers from the Dental Hope mission visited the community. In addition, American medical volunteers visited Kherson region to help local residents.
